Spatial coding supports auditory conceptual navigation

Grid cells in human entorhinal cortex encode spatial layouts for real-world navigation, yet their role in conceptual navigation remains unclear. Here we show that mentally transforming tones within a purely auditory pitch-duration space engages spatial circuits, and that such resources are causally necessary. In Experiment 1, participants trained for five days to navigate through a purely conceptual pitch-duration auditory space, then underwent fMRI on Day 6. We observed a six-fold modulation of entorhinal BOLD signals aligned to each participants trajectory angles, similar to grid-cell firing in physical space. Stronger grid-like coding predicted larger training-related gains. In Experiment 2, a new cohort performed the same task under either a spatial or non-spatial interference load. Only the spatial condition selectively disrupted performance on trials requiring mental "movement," indicating a causal reliance on spatial resources. These findings provide evidence that auditory conceptual transformations recruit--and depend on--spatial grid-like computations in the entorhinal-hippocampal system, pointing to a domain-general role for spatial coding in organizing new knowledge along continuous dimensions.
